Middle School
The Concept School curriculum focuses on essential questions to guide student-centered learning with grade-appropriate material to create meaningful learning experiences for all students.

At the Middle School level, autonomy is encouraged and developed. Guided instructional strategies and study skills promote confidence and success. Through cooperative learning activities, individualized instruction, adaptations, and accommodations, all students have access to the curriculum. All students are required to take Reading, English, Math, Science, and Social Studies daily. Music, Gym, Art, and Technology are offered weekly. An elective class is often offered based on student and teacher interest. Frequent field trips promote meaningful learning experiences.
